> In the last few years California runs 100% renewable on many days (and growing) every year.
How many is "many days"? Gas is still used for at least one fifth of electricity. https://app.electricitymaps.com/map/zone/US-CAL-CISO/5y/monthly https://app.electricitymaps.com/map/zone/US-CAL-CISO/5y/mont...
- eliben 6mo agoAccording to the official tracker (https://www.energy.ca.gov/data-reports/clean-energy-serving-california/tracking-progress-toward-100-clean-energy https://www.energy.ca.gov/data-reports/clean-energy-serving-... and elsewhere) there were 279 days in 2025 where California was on 100% renewable for _some_ time during the day (could be hours, could be minutes at mid-day). In total hours equivalent of 77.3 full days over 2025.
